Description of the colonial zone of Cuenca:

The richness of its architecture and culture in general earned Cuenca the appointment of Cultural Heritage of Humanity, on December 1, 1999. The Historic Center, with about 200 hectares, is formed by the oldest residential area. Here we find a great number of buildings of colonial style and Republican of great beauty; the archaeological zone; the artisan neighborhoods (of colonial origin); the central markets; the Tomebamba Ravine with Paseo 3 de Noviembre and several places of cultural and scenic importance that show the reason for the declaration as a city Cultural Heritage.
